🌟 Gateway of India - Mumbai's Iconic Landmark 🇮🇳✨

The Gateway of India is one of Mumbai's most celebrated tourist attractions and a must-visit spot for history lovers and photographers alike. 🏛️ Located on the waterfront in Colaba, this grand archway was built in 1924 to commemorate the visit of King George V and Queen Mary. Today, it's a symbol of Mumbai’s colonial heritage and resilience.

What to Expect:

Stunning Indo-Saracenic architecture 🕌

Views of the Arabian Sea 🌊

A bustling vibe with tourists, local vendors, and photographers 📸

Ferry rides to Elephanta Caves ⛴️


Best Time to Visit: Early morning or evening for cooler weather and gorgeous lighting.

Tips:

Free entry

Safe area with lots of street food nearby 🍢

Close to Taj Mahal Palace Hotel 🏨
